About Grab Holdings Limited (GRAB)

Before we jump into Grab Holdings Limited’s stock price, history, target price and what caused it to recently rise, let’s take a look at some background.

Grab Holdings Limited operates the Grab superapp in Cambodia, Indonesia, Malaysia, Myanmar, the Philippines, Singapore, Thailand, and Vietnam. The company offers delivery services on its platform, such as GrabFood, a food ordering and delivery booking service; Dine-Out for table reservations; GrabMart, a goods ordering and delivery booking service; GrabAds, an online advertising solution; GrabExpress, a package delivery booking service; Grab for Business platform, a unified management portal for corporate clients. It also provides GrabKios, a network of agents; GrabCar, which enables a private hire driver-partner to register with Grab and accept bookings through its driver-partner application; and GrabTaxi, which enables a taxi driver-partner to register with Grab and accept bookings through the Grab driver-partner application. In addition, the company offers JustGrab, which enables consumers to book a private car or a traditional taxi; GrabBike, a motorcycle ride-hailing offering; three-wheel vehicles for culturally localized modes; carpooling shared mobility options; GrabRentals, which facilitates vehicle rental for its driver-partners; GrabPay, a digital payments solution; and GrabCoins, a loyalty platform. Further, it provides GrabFin for financial services comprising digital and offline lending, PayLater services, white goods financing, receivables factoring, and working capital loans; GrabInsure, aprotection for rides and package deliveries, personal accident insurance, income protection insurance, critical illness insurance, vehicle insurance, and travel insurance; GrabLink, a payment gateway and acquiring service; Digibank Savings Account, a digital banking deposit account. Additionally, the company offers GX Bank debit cards; GXS FlexiCard, a fee-based credit card; and mapping services, autonomous vehicle services, and last-mile delivery infrastructure. Grab Holdings Limited was founded in 2012 and is headquartered in Singapore, Singapore.

Grab Holdings Limited’s Stock Price as of Market Close

As of September 11, 2026, 4:00 PM, CST, Grab Holdings Limited’s stock price was $3.050.

Grab Holdings Limited is up 1.33% from its previous closing price of $3.010.

During the last market session, Grab Holdings Limited’s stock traded between $2.960 and $3.060. Currently, there are approximately 4,084.86 million shares outstanding for Grab Holdings Limited.

Grab Holdings Limited’s price-earnings (P/E) ratio is currently at 26.8, which is low compared to the Ground Transportation industry median of 30.9. The price-earnings ratio gauges market expectation of future performance by relating a stock’s current share price to its earnings per share.

Grab Holdings Limited Stock Price History

Grab Holdings Limited’s (GRAB) price is currently down 13.84% so far this month.

During the month of September, Grab Holdings Limited’s stock price has reached a high of $3.620 and a low of $2.960.

Over the last year, Grab Holdings Limited has hit prices as high as $6.620 and as low as $2.960. Year to date, Grab Holdings Limited’s stock is down 38.88%.
